Well, it is a holiday weekend - and here in the Mid Atlantic everyone seems to be headed to the beach (DE) or the shore (NJ). To any of you in the midwest or on the West Coast - that may seem like a conundrum. Arent they the same ocean and the same style beach, just across a state line? Yes, they are. Its just a regional thing.
